namespace SharpMap.Data.Providers
{
/// <summary>
/// Microsoft SQL data provider
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// <para>
/// The SQL data table MUST contain five data columns: A binary or image column (a Geometry Column) for storing WKB formatted geometries,
/// and four real values holding the boundingbox of the geometry. These must be named: Envelope_MinX, Envelope_MinY, Envelope_MaxX and Envelope_MaxY.
/// Any extra columns will be returns as feature data.
/// </para>
/// <para>For creating a valid MS SQL datatable for SharpMap, see <see cref="CreateDataTable"/>
/// for creating and uploading a datasource to MS SQL Server.</para>
/// <example>
/// Adding a datasource to a layer:
/// <code lang="C#">
/// SharpMap.Layers.VectorLayer myLayer = new SharpMap.Layers.VectorLayer("My layer");
/// string ConnStr = @"Data Source=.\SQLEXPRESS;AttachDbFilename=|DataDirectory|GeoDatabase.mdf;Integrated Security=True;User Instance=True";
/// myLayer.DataSource = new SharpMap.Data.Providers.MsSql(ConnStr, "myTable");
/// </code>
/// </example>
/// </remarks>

/// <summary>
/// Returns geometries within the specified bounding box
/// </summary>
/// <param name="bbox"></param>
/// <returns></returns>
public Collection<Geometries.Geometry> GetGeometriesInView(SharpMap.Geometries.BoundingBox bbox)
{
Collection<Geometries.Geometry> features = new Collection<SharpMap.Geometries.Geometry>();
using (SqlConnection conn = new SqlConnection(_ConnectionString))
{
string BoxIntersect = GetBoxClause(bbox);
string strSQL = "SELECT " + this.GeometryColumn + " AS Geom ";
strSQL += "FROM " + this.Table + " WHERE ";
strSQL += BoxIntersect;
if (!String.IsNullOrEmpty(_defintionQuery))
strSQL += " AND " + this.DefinitionQuery;
using (SqlCommand command = new SqlCommand(strSQL, conn))
{
conn.Open();
using (SqlDataReader dr = command.ExecuteReader())
{
while (dr.Read())
{
if (dr[0] != DBNull.Value)
{
SharpMap.Geometries.Geometry geom = SharpMap.Converters.WellKnownBinary.GeometryFromWKB.Parse((byte[])dr[0]);
if (geom != null)
features.Add(geom);
}
}
}
conn.Close();
}
}
return features;
}
